IIFA Awards or International Indian Film Academy Awards is a prestigious award ceremony organized by the International Indian Film Academy in which awards are presented to the film personalities of the Hindi film industry for honouring their artistic and technical eminence. The event was introduced in the year 2000 and since then it is held every year at different places of the world. IIFA Awards has, over the years, played a crucial role in promoting the Indian cinema at the international arena. During this three day event, awards are given to the film professionals under varied categories as recognition to their contributions in diverse cinematic arenas.
20th IIFA Awards
20th IIFA Awards was held on 18 September 2019. For the first time in the Awards' history, it was held in India, Mumbai. The show was hosted by Ayushmann Khurrana and Aparshakti Khurana. The nominees were announced on 28 August 2019. This IIFA Award for Best Female Playback was given to Harshdeep Kaur and Vibha Saraf for the song ‘Dilbaro’ from the movie ‘Raazi’.
